MARIONETTE is an immersive installation by Sven Sauer and us exploring manipulated truth, deepfakes and the instability of perceived reality. Combining a tent-like environment, simulated lightning and immersive sound, the work creates a perceptual space suspended between shelter, uncertainty and geopolitical tension.
The installation’s lightning simulations are based on rocket detonation tracking data from February 22, 2022. Sudden flashes of light repeatedly interrupt the darkened environment and destabilize the perception of what is real, artificial or manipulated. The work creates a contrast between the apparent safety of the enclosed space and the violence referenced through the underlying data.
We developed the piano composition and spatial sound environment for the installation. A continuous thunderstorm soundscape accompanies the changing light behaviour and reinforces the installation’s immersive atmosphere. Sound supports the emotional tension of the environment while drawing visitors deeper into its fragile and uncertain perceptual world.
Our contribution focused on composition and spatial sound design. Marionette explores how immersive sound can shape emotional perception within installations dealing with uncertainty, manipulation and mediated reality.
